Aerogel powder is a light-weight, very porous material made by changing the liquid in a gel with gas. This leaves behind a strong that is primarily air– as much as 99.8%– yet still solid enough to handle industrial use. When made use of in high voltage tools, this powder functions as an excellent thermal and electric insulator. Its framework traps air in little pockets, which slows down warmth transfer and blocks electric currents from dripping where they should not go. Unlike typical insulators like fiberglass or mineral woollen, aerogel powder offers remarkable efficiency in a much thinner layer. Why Usage Aerogel Powder in High Voltage Applications? .

High voltage equipment runs hot and lugs serious risks if insulation fails. Conventional products typically weaken over time, take in dampness, or take up excessive area. Aerogel powder fixes these troubles. It resists water, stays secure across extreme temperature levels, and does not perform electrical energy. Due to the fact that it’s so light and thin, designers can develop smaller, a lot more efficient devices without sacrificing security. Likewise, its lengthy life expectancy means less substitutes and lower upkeep prices. In settings like power substations or offshore platforms, integrity is non-negotiable– and aerogel provides. Exactly How Is Aerogel Powder Applied in Insulation Equipments? .

Applying aerogel powder isn’t made complex, yet it does call for smart combination. Many typically, the powder is mixed into coatings, installed in versatile tapes, or loaded into custom-shaped insulation components. In high voltage setups, it’s commonly used inside composite wraps that hug wires or frame busbars. These covers combine the powder with sturdy materials or polymers to produce an obstacle that’s both hard and thermally immune. The powder can also be included in phase-change products (PCMs) to boost their capability to shop and launch warm steadily– a helpful feature for handling temperature level spikes in electrical cupboards. Where Is Aerogel Powder Used in Real-World High Voltage Devices? .

You’ll discover aerogel powder in many vital power facilities arrangements. It’s used in underground transmission lines, where area is tight and moisture is consistent. It’s likewise usual in mobile substations and renewable resource installations like solar inverters and wind generator converters– places where getting too hot can shut down whole systems. Electric car charging terminals rely upon it too, considering that quick battery chargers generate intense warmth throughout operation. Also aerospace and protection fields make use of aerogel-insulated elements for radar and power distribution units that need to work faultlessly under anxiety. The vital benefit across all these uses is uniformity: aerogel does the exact same in -50 ° C Arctic winds or +200 ° C desert warmth. And due to the fact that it does not sag, work out, or press with time, the insulation stays reliable for years without rework.

Frequently Asked Questions Regarding Aerogel Powder for High Voltage Insulation .

Is aerogel powder safe to deal with? Yes. Modern aerogel powders are engineered to be non-toxic and non-irritating. Still, basic safety gear like gloves and masks is advised during handling, just as with any fine particle product.

Does it conduct power? No. Pure silica aerogel is an exceptional electric insulator. It has incredibly high dielectric stamina, suggesting it can withstand solid electric areas without damaging down.

Can it get wet? Aerogel powder itself is hydrophobic– it wards off water. However, if it becomes part of a composite material, the general water resistance depends on the other components. Many business high-voltage wraps using aerogel are fully sealed versus moisture ingress.

How long does it last? Aerogel doesn’t age like natural foams. It won’t rot, wear away, or lose insulating worth with time. In secure problems, it can do dependably for decades.

Is it expensive? It utilized to be, but mass production and enhanced manufacturing have brought prices down significantly. When you factor in energy savings, lowered downtime, and longer tools life, the return on investment is commonly very solid.

Can it be utilized outdoors? Absolutely. Many outside high-voltage applications already make use of aerogel-based insulation because it handles UV direct exposure, rain, and temperature level swings without breaking down.
